Industial adiabatic system PADS

Intake air humidification system using special adiabatic panels. The panels, placed in front of the heat exchangers on the air intake side, are homogeneously saturated through a distribution system without recirculation of water. The air, passing through the panels, increases its humidity and becomes cooler according to the different operating conditions.

Characteristic

  • “PADS” panel for water distribution, located above the air intake.

  • Mounted and wired electrical switchboard; a speed controller (R, I, U, D) mounted inside the control panel regulates the adiabatic system.

  • Solenoid valves to drain the system.

  • Safety thermostat to drain the system during cold months.

  • Pressure regulator to regulate necessary pressure and valves to regulate exhaust air.

  • Multilayer UV resistant piping.

  • Humidity sensor to control ambient humidity.

Advantages

  • The unit can be selected to match the design air inlet temperature, which is significantly lower than the ambient temperature (TCALC << TAMB) (see psychrometric chart example).
  • A smaller sized unit with a smaller heat transfer surface may be selected.
  • This device can be used to cool the liquid to a temperature lower than the ambient temperature.
  • The industrial adiabatic system in combination with electronically switched “EC” fans, “Intelliboard” PLC or speed controller, reduces energy consumption, noise emission and optimizes water consumption.
  • No risk of legionella contamination.
